PHP批量删除jQuery操作


Posted in PHP onJuly 23, 2017

效果图如下所述:

PHP批量删除jQuery操作—>—>—>PHP批量删除jQuery操作
PHP批量删除jQuery操作—>—>—>PHP批量删除jQuery操作

创建视图show.php

<?php 
 header('content-type:text/html;charset=utf-8');
 $pdo=new PDO('mysql:host=localhost;dbname=***;','root','root');
 $pdo->exec('set names utf8');
 $sql='select * from ***';
 $info=$pdo->query($sql)->fetchAll(PDO::FETCH_ASSOC);
?>
<center>
<table border="1">
 <tr>
  <td>id</td>
  <td>title</td>
  <td>content</td>
 </tr>
 <?php foreach($info as $k => $v){ ?>
 <tr>
  <td><input type="checkbox" name="box" value="<?= $v['id'] ?>"><?= $v['id'] ?></td>
  <td><?= $v['title'] ?></td>
  <td><?= $v['content'] ?></td>
 </tr>
 <?php } ?>
</table>
 <button>批量删除</button>
</center>
<script src="../jquery.1.12.min.js"></script>
<script>
 $(function(){
  $('button').click(function(){
   var ids=$(':checkbox');
   var str='';
   var count=0;
   for(var i=0;i<ids.length;i++){
    if(ids.eq(i).is(':checked')){
     str+=','+ids.eq(i).val();
     count++;
    }
   }
   var str=str.substr(1);
   if(confirm('你确定要删除这'+count+'条数据吗?')){
    //获取id后删除
    $.ajax({
     type:'get',
     url:'adminDel.php',
     data:{str:str},
     success:function(res){
      if(res>0){
       alert('删除成功');
       for(var i=ids.length-1;i>=0;i--){
        if(ids.eq(i).is(':checked')){
         ids.eq(i).parent().parent().remove();
        }
       }
      }
     }
    })
   }
   return false;
   /*var box=document.getElementsByName('box');
   var str="";
   for(var i=0;i<box.length;i++){
    if(box[i].checked==true){
     str+=','+box[i].value;
    }
   }
   var str=str.substr(1);
   alert(str);*/
  });
 })
</script>

创建adminDel.php

<?php 
 header('content-type:text/html;charset=utf-8');
 $str=$_GET['str'];
 $pdo=new PDO('mysql:host=localhost;dbname=***;','root','root');
 $pdo->exec('set names utf8');
 $sql='delete from *** where id in ('.$str.')';
 $res=$pdo->exec($sql);
 //受影响行数
 echo $res;
?>

以上所述是小编给大家介绍的PHP批量删除jQuery操作,希望对大家有所帮助,如果大家有任何疑问欢迎给我留言,小编会及时回复大家的。

PHP 相关文章推荐
php中$this-&amp;gt;含义分析
Nov 29 PHP
PHP闭包(Closure)使用详解
May 02 PHP
解析coreseek for sphinx的使用
Jun 21 PHP
保存到桌面、设为桌面且带图标的PHP代码
Nov 19 PHP
thinkphp使用phpmailer发送邮件的方法
Nov 24 PHP
php字符串操作常见问题小结
Oct 11 PHP
常用PHP封装分页工具类
Jan 14 PHP
php写app接口并返回json数据的实例(分享)
May 20 PHP
Laravel5.7框架安装与使用学习笔记图文详解
Apr 02 PHP
Laravel Eloquent分表方法并使用模型关联的实现
Nov 25 PHP
PhpStorm+xdebug+postman调试技巧分享
Sep 15 PHP
php实现记事本案例
Oct 20 PHP
PHP mysqli事务操作常用方法分析
Jul 22 #PHP
PHP实现mysqli批量执行多条语句的方法示例
Jul 22 #PHP
PHP编程文件处理类SplFileObject和SplFileInfo用法实例分析
Jul 22 #PHP
PHP编程快速实现数组去重的方法详解
Jul 22 #PHP
php使用ftp实现文件上传与下载功能
Jul 21 #PHP
YII2框架中excel表格导出的方法详解
Jul 21 #PHP
实例讲解YII2中多表关联的使用方法
Jul 21 #PHP
You might like
js对象之JS入门之Array对象操作小结
2011/01/09 Javascript
Javascript玩转继承(三)
2014/05/08 Javascript
JS替换字符串中字符即替换全部而不是第一个
2014/06/04 Javascript
JS实现的网页倒计时数字时钟效果
2015/03/02 Javascript
jQuery事件绑定与解除绑定实现方法
2015/04/15 Javascript
jquery Easyui快速开发总结
2015/08/20 Javascript
JavaScript制作颜色反转小游戏
2016/09/25 Javascript
jquery实现一个全局计时器(商城可用)
2017/06/30 jQuery
ExtJs整合Echarts的示例代码
2018/02/27 Javascript
Vue 使用 Mint UI 实现左滑删除效果CellSwipe
2018/04/27 Javascript
解决修复npm安装全局模块权限的问题
2018/05/17 Javascript
详解express + mock让前后台并行开发
2018/06/06 Javascript
layui实现数据表格隐藏列的示例
2019/10/25 Javascript
JS script脚本中async和defer区别详解
2020/06/24 Javascript
javascript实现京东登录显示隐藏密码
2020/08/02 Javascript
JS获取一个字符串中指定字符串第n次出现的位置
2021/02/10 Javascript
[02:53]DOTA2英雄昆卡基础教程
2013/11/25 DOTA
[36:43]NB vs Optic 2018国际邀请赛小组赛BO1 B组加赛 8.19
2018/08/21 DOTA
[52:05]EG vs OG 2019国际邀请赛小组赛 BO2 第二场 8.16
2019/08/18 DOTA
python正则分组的应用
2013/11/10 Python
python3实现暴力穷举博客园密码
2016/06/19 Python
Python 高级专用类方法的实例详解
2017/09/11 Python
python实现csv格式文件转为asc格式文件的方法
2018/03/23 Python
记一次python 内存泄漏问题及解决过程
2018/11/29 Python
python实现邮件发送功能
2019/08/10 Python
在pycharm中显示python画的图方法
2019/08/31 Python
使用PyCharm进行远程开发和调试的实现
2019/11/04 Python
tensorflow 报错unitialized value的解决方法
2020/02/06 Python
简约控的天堂:The Undone
2016/12/21 全球购物
iHerb香港:维生素、补充剂和天然保健品
2017/08/01 全球购物
美国领先的水果篮送货公司和新鲜水果供应商:The Fruit Company
2018/02/13 全球购物
SportsDirect.com新加坡:英国第一体育零售商
2019/03/30 全球购物
空字符串(“”)和null的区别
2012/11/13 面试题
销售人员职业生涯规划范文
2014/03/01 职场文书
优秀本科毕业生自荐信
2014/07/04 职场文书
JavaScript最完整的深浅拷贝实现方式详解
2022/02/28 Javascript